C++ Erase-remove

Erase-remove is the idiomatic way to remove elements matching a condition from a container: remove moves matching elements to the end and returns a new end iterator, then erase removes them. This avoids iterator invalidation issues and works with all standard containers.

Use the erase-remove idiom to safely and efficiently remove elements from containers.

Example

This example shows the erase-remove idiom removing elements by value and by condition.

// compile: g++ -o erase erase.cpp
// run: ./erase
// description: erase-remove idiom safely removes elements from containers
 
#include <iostream>
#include <vector>
#include <algorithm>
 
int main() {
    std::vector<int> v{1, 2, 3, 2, 4, 2, 5};
 
    // Remove all 2's using erase-remove
    v.erase(std::remove(v.begin(), v.end(), 2), v.end());
 
    // Remove all even numbers
    std::vector<int> v2{1, 2, 3, 4, 5, 6};
    v2.erase(
        std::remove_if(v2.begin(), v2.end(), 
                       [](int x) { return x % 2 == 0; }),
        v2.end()
    );
 
    std::cout << "After removal: ";
    for (int x : v2) std::cout << x << " ";
    std::cout << "\n";
 
    return 0;
}
